                Re: Is NCAA 11 the 2k5 killer?

                Gameplay wise, I think NCAA 11 is one of the best games in year. As far as presentation/atmosphere goes 2k5 blows any other football game out of the water.

                I do not understand why NCAA does not fully take advantage of the ESPN license. Outside of the pre-game and the scoreboard it isn't really in that game. Where 2k5 had halftime shows, weekly shows, a lot of stat overlays, starting line-ups, etc.

                I love NCAA 11, but the presentation just isn't there.

                              Re: Is NCAA 11 the 2k5 killer?

                              I loved 2k5, but NCAA is the better game. In 2k5 the CPU passing game would always be 50% or less with at least 3 INTs, lack of yards after the catch, and every run was either a huge gain or no gain at all. It was also really hard to avoid getting sacked less than 4-5 times/game.

                              It was a great game and had better commentary, presentation, sidelines, and the shows and stuff, but there were definitely things in that game that would be considered "game killers" if they were to happen in Madden (mainly the CPU INTs). 2k5 was great for its time and especially for the price, but that was over 5 years ago.

                              NCAA 11 has far fewer annoyances and plays a more realistic game of football in my opinion (as far as stats, scores, etc.) It's the better game.
